Electro-Hydrodynamic Instabilities in Main Chain Thermotropic Liquid Crystalline Polyesters
1984
Abstract We have investigated the response behavior of the thermotropic nematic polymer, DDA-9, in an electric field. DDA-9 is composed of regularly alternating moieties and flexible spacers. At a critical threshold voltage, dependent on molar mass, these polymers show the onset of instability. The appearance of a (non-fluctuating) striped pattern (Williams domains) is shown and the time of formation and relaxation of these patterns is investigated as a function of applied Voltage.

Estimation of Number-Average Molecular Weights of Copolymers by Gel Permeation Chromatography−Light Scattering
1996
The true number-average molecular weight, Mn, of copolymers is obtained by GPC coupled with a light-scattering detector even if the composition and therefore the refractive index increment varies with elution volume, provided slices taken are monodisperse with respect to molecular weight and composition. In contrast, only an apparent weight-average molecular weight, can be obtained by the conventional GPC−light scattering combination, even for a perfect chromatographic resolution. The errors in Mn associated with nonhomogeneous slices are estimated. Kinetic analysis of "living" polymerization processes exhibiting slow equilibria. 6. Cationic polymerization involving covalent species, ion pairs, a…
1996
The kinetics of cationic polymerization is studied theoretically in accordance with a three-state mechanism which consists of two successive equilibria: the ionization/ion collapse equilibrium between covalent species and ion pairs, and the subsequent dissociation/association equilibrium between ion pairs and free ions. The number- and weight-average degrees of polymerization and the polydispersity index (PDI), Pw/Pn, are derived.
